Sample: AxisCaps
|
<%@ Page Language="C#" debug="true" Description="dotnetCHARTING Component" %> <%@ Register TagPrefix="dotnet" Namespace="dotnetCHARTING" Assembly="dotnetCHARTING"%> <%@ Import Namespace="System.Drawing" %> <%@ Import Namespace="System.Drawing.Drawing2D" %> <html xmlns="http://www.w3.org/1999/xhtml"> <head> <title>Aixs Caps</title> <script runat="server">
void Page_Load(Object sender,EventArgs e) {
Chart.Type = ChartType.Scatter; Chart.Width = 600; Chart.Height = 350; Chart.TempDirectory = "temp"; Chart.Debug = true; Chart.DefaultSeries.Type = SeriesType.Line; // This sample will demonstrate axis line caps. // First we get our data, if you would like to get the data from a database you need to use // the data engine. See sample: features/dataEngine.aspx. Or the dataEngine tutorial in the help file. SeriesCollection mySC = getRandomData(); // We'll make the axis line a translucent black color and add some width so the caps can be seen better. Chart.DefaultAxis.Line.Color = Color.FromArgb(255,0,0,0); Chart.DefaultAxis.Line.Width = 5;
// The axis lines are drawn from origin. If the origin is in the middle of the chart, two axis lines are drawn. // Axis lines can be marked with caps like so: Chart.DefaultAxis.Line.StartCap = LineCap.RoundAnchor; Chart.DefaultAxis.Line.EndCap = LineCap.ArrowAnchor; // This will mark all the lines in the same manner.
// Add the some random data. Chart.SeriesCollection.Add(mySC); }
SeriesCollection getRandomData() { SeriesCollection SC = new SeriesCollection(); Random myR = new Random(); for(int a = 1; a < 5; a++) { Series s = new Series(); s.Name = "Series " + a; for(int b = 1; b < 5; b++) { Element e = new Element(); e.Name = "Element " + b; e.YValue = -25 + myR.Next(50); e.XValue = -25 + myR.Next(50); s.Elements.Add(e); } SC.Add(s); }
return SC; }
</script> </head> <body> <div style="text-align:center"> <dotnet:Chart id="Chart" runat="server" Width="568px" Height="344px"> </dotnet:Chart> </div> </body> </html>
